NVIDIA Vera Rubin Maximizes Intelligence per Dollar for Post-Training Workloads – a Key Metric for Agentic AI

NVIDIA Kirthi Develeker

NVIDIA introduced the Vera Rubin platform designed to optimize post-training workloads for agentic AI models that continuously adapt and learn from production environments. The Nemotron 3 Ultra model achieved 71.7% on SWE-bench by fixing real software bugs, with Vera Rubin reducing GPU requirements by 75% compared to the previous Blackwell generation for the same training tasks. This shift makes continuous post-training economically viable, allowing AI systems to maintain and improve intelligence throughout their operational lifetime rather than as a one-time process.
